6th Annual Pit Firing at Mayor Bill Frederick Park at Turkey Lake

WHAT: ORLANDO, FL. (January 18, 2006) – During the weekend of January 21st, the City of Orlando will host its 6th Annual Pottery Pit Firing event at Mayor Bill Fredrick Park at Turkey Lake. As part of the City’s commitment to the arts, the Families, Parks and Recreation Department’s “Pottery Studio” will facilitate a pottery firing experience that emulates a historical firing process used by the Native American Indian and African cultures.

Joe Battiato, California clay artist, will facilitate the digging and preparation of a 20-diameter pit on Saturday. Then, on Sunday, the pit will be ignited and will burn for the course of the day during which there will be a performance by a live jazz, blues band and a cook out/pot luck lunch.

Admission to participate in the hands-on experience is $45.00 per person. Special student rates and guest observer rates are available.
